8/10 Very good

Beacon 1750 is a "you get what you pay for" boutique hotel. Even modest hotels near the city center cost at least $300/night, so for $200/night this property met my expectations. First, it's about 2 miles (15 minutes on the trolley) west of the metro/tourist zone in a residential neighborhood. Second, it's rough around the edges but functional. The negatives: the bathroom was tiny, the towels thin, there were no outlets near the beds and the room was clean enough but not immaculate. The positives: the hotel feels very safe, the beds were comfortable and it was very easy transporting to and from "the city".

In desperate need of a glow up

Have you ever wondered what it would be like to stay in a dusty old doll house? Here's your chance. Hotel Beacon Inn 1750 is a conundrum. The location is great, right on the T, Green Line, with easy access to the medical district, Fenway, and nice restaurants/cafés within walking distance. The price is a good value for Brookline. The front desk attendant was friendly. The problem is this old girl has seen better days. Check in is mashed up with the 'breakfast' service area, just inside the front door. The rooms are in rough shape, and the bathroom was in bad shape. The brand new television hung on the wall didn't work. No night tables by the bed and only two outlets in the room. The window air conditioner was taped into the window. Hotel Beacon Inn 1750 needs a glow up in the worst way but has a few good attributes most specifically location and walkability.
